Compartilhar via


Editor da Tarefa Transferir Objetos do SQL Server (página Objetos)

Use a página Objetos da caixa de diálogo Editor da Tarefa Transferir Objetos do SQL Server para especificar propriedades para copiar um ou mais objetos do SQL Server de uma instância do SQL Server para outra. Tabelas, exibições, procedimentos armazenados e funções definidas pelo usuário são alguns exemplos de objetos do SQL Server que você pode copiar. Para obter mais informações sobre essa tarefa, consulte Tarefa Transferir Objetos do SQL Server.

ObservaçãoObservação

O usuário que criar a tarefa Transferir Objetos do SQL Server deve ter permissões suficientes nos objetos do servidor de origem para selecioná-los para cópia, bem como permissão para acessar o banco de dados do servidor de destino no qual os objetos serão transferidos.

Opções estáticas

  • SourceConnection
    Selecione um gerenciador de conexões SMO na lista ou clique em <Nova conexão...> para criar uma nova conexão com o servidor de origem.

  • SourceDatabase
    Selecione o banco de dados no servidor de origem do qual serão copiados os objetos.

  • DestinationConnection
    Selecione um gerenciador de conexões SMO na lista ou clique em <Nova conexão...> para criar uma nova conexão com o servidor de destino.

  • DestinationDatabase
    Selecione o banco de dados no servidor de destino para o qual serão copiados os objetos.

  • DropObjectsFirst
    Selecione se os objetos selecionados serão primeiro descartados no servidor de destino, antes de serem copiados.

  • IncludeExtendedProperties
    Selecione se as propriedades estendidas devem ser incluídas quando os objetos forem copiados da origem para o servidor de destino.

  • CopyData
    Selecione se os dados devem ser incluídos quando os objetos forem copiados da origem para o servidor de destino.

  • ExistingData
    Especifique como os dados serão copiados para o servidor de destino. As opções dessa propriedade estão listadas na seguinte tabela:

    Valor

    Descrição

    Replace

    Os dados no servidor de destino serão substituídos.

    Append

    Os dados copiados do servidor de origem serão anexados aos dados existentes no servidor de destino.

    ObservaçãoObservação

    A opção ExistingData só ficará disponível quando CopyData for definido como Verdadeiro.

  • CopySchema
    Selecione se o esquema deve ser copiado durante a tarefa Transferir Objetos do SQL Server.

    ObservaçãoObservação

    CopySchema só está disponível para o SQL Server.

  • UseCollation
    Selecione se a transferência de objetos deve incluir o agrupamento especificado no servidor de origem.

  • IncludeDependentObjects
    Selecione se a cópia dos objetos selecionados deve ser agrupada em cascata para incluir outros objetos que dependem deles para serem copiados.

  • CopyAllObjects
    Selecione se a tarefa deve copiar todos os objetos no banco de dados de origem especificado ou apenas objetos selecionados. Ao definir essa opção como Falso será possível selecionar os objetos a transferir e exibir as opções dinâmicas na seção CopyAllObjects.

  • ObjectsToCopy
    Expanda ObjectsToCopy para especificar quais objetos devem ser copiados do banco de dados de origem para o banco de dados de destino.

    ObservaçãoObservação

    ObjectsToCopy só ficará disponível quando CopyAllObjects for definido como Falso.

    As opções para copiar os seguintes tipos de objeto têm suporte apenas no SQL Server:

    Assemblies

    Funções de partição

    Esquemas de partição

    Esquemas

    Agregados definidos pelo usuário

    Tipos definidos pelo usuário

    Coleções de esquemas XML

  • CopyDatabaseUsers
    Especifique se os usuários do banco de dados devem ser incluídos na transferência.

  • CopyDatabaseRoles
    Especifique se as funções do banco de dados devem ser incluídas na transferência.

  • CopySqlServerLogins
    Especifique se os logons do SQL Server devem ser incluídos na transferência.

  • CopyObjectLevelPermissions
    Especifique se as permissões de nível de objeto devem ser incluídas na transferência.

  • CopyIndexes
    Especifique se os índices devem ser incluídos na transferência.

  • CopyTriggers
    Especifique se os gatilhos devem ser incluídos na transferência.

  • CopyFullTextIndexes
    Especifique se os índices de texto completo devem ser incluídos na transferência.

  • CopyPrimaryKeys
    Especifique se as chaves primárias devem ser incluídas na transferência.

  • CopyForeignKeys
    Especifique se as chaves estrangeiras devem ser incluídas na transferência.

  • GenerateScriptsInUnicode
    Especifique se os scripts de transferência gerados estão em formato Unicode.

Opções Dinâmicas

CopyAllObjects = False

  • CopyAllTables
    Selecione se a tarefa deve copiar todas as tabelas no banco de dados de origem especificado ou apenas as tabelas selecionadas.

  • TablesList
    Clique para abrir a caixa de diálogo Selecionar Tabelas.

  • CopyAllViews
    Selecione se a tarefa deve copiar todas as exibições no banco de dados de origem especificado ou apenas as exibições selecionadas.

  • ViewsList
    Clique para abrir a caixa de diálogo Selecionar Exibições.

  • CopyAllStoredProcedures
    Selecione se a tarefa deve copiar todos os procedimentos armazenados definidos pelo usuário no banco de dados de origem especificado ou apenas os procedimentos selecionados.

  • StoredProceduresList
    Clique para abrir a caixa de diálogo Selecionar Procedimentos Armazenados.

  • CopyAllUserDefinedFunctions
    Selecione se a tarefa deve copiar todas as funções definidas pelo usuário no banco de dados de origem especificado ou apenas as funções selecionadas.

  • UserDefinedFunctionsList
    Clique para abrir a caixa de diálogo Selecionar Funções Definidas pelo Usuário.

  • CopyAllDefaults
    Selecione se a tarefa deve copiar todos os padrões no banco de dados de origem especificado ou apenas os padrões selecionados.

  • DefaultsList
    Clique para abrir a caixa de diálogo Selecionar Padrões.

  • CopyAllUserDefinedDataTypes
    Selecione se a tarefa deve copiar todos os tipos de dados definidos pelo usuário no banco de dados de origem especificado ou apenas os tipos de dados selecionados.

  • UserDefinedDataTypesList
    Clique para abrir a caixa de diálogo Selecionar Tipos de Dados Definidos pelo Usuário.

  • CopyAllPartitionFunctions
    Selecione se a tarefa deve copiar todas as funções de partição definidas pelo usuário no banco de dados de origem especificado ou apenas as funções de partição selecionadas. Suporte oferecido apenas no SQL Server.

  • PartitionFunctionsList
    Clique para abrir a caixa de diálogo Selecionar Funções de Partição.

  • CopyAllPartitionSchemes
    Selecione se a tarefa deve copiar todos os esquemas de partição definidos pelo usuário no banco de dados de origem especificado ou apenas os esquemas de partição selecionados. Suporte oferecido apenas no SQL Server.

  • PartitionSchemesList
    Clique para abrir a caixa de diálogo Selecionar Esquemas de Partição.

  • CopyAllSchemas
    Selecione se a tarefa deve copiar todos os esquemas no banco de dados de origem especificado ou apenas os esquemas selecionados. Suporte oferecido apenas no SQL Server.

  • SchemasList
    Clique para abrir a caixa de diálogo Selecionar Esquemas.

  • CopyAllSqlAssemblies
    Selecione se a tarefa deve copiar todos os assemblies do SQL no banco de dados de origem especificado ou apenas os assemblies do SQL selecionados. Suporte oferecido apenas no SQL Server.

  • SqlAssembliesList
    Clique para abrir a caixa de diálogo Selecionar Assemblies do SQL.

  • CopyAllUserDefinedAggregates
    Selecione se a tarefa deve copiar todos os agregados definidos pelo usuário no banco de dados de origem especificado ou apenas os agregados selecionados. Suporte oferecido apenas no SQL Server.

  • UserDefinedAggregatesList
    Clique para abrir a caixa de diálogo Selecionar Agregados Definidos pelo Usuário.

  • CopyAllUserDefinedTypes
    Selecione se a tarefa deve copiar todos os tipos definidos pelo usuário no banco de dados de origem especificado ou apenas os tipos selecionados. Suporte encontrado apenas no SQL Server.

  • UserDefinedTypes
    Clique para abrir a caixa de diálogo Selecionar Tipos Definidos pelo Usuário.

  • CopyAllXmlSchemaCollections
    Selecione se a tarefa deve copiar todas as coleções de Esquemas XML no banco de dados de origem especificado ou apenas as coleções de esquemas XML selecionadas. Suporte oferecido apenas no SQL Server.

  • XmlSchemaCollectionsList
    Clique para abrir a caixa de diálogo Selecionar Coleções de Esquemas XML.